Agreement with AirBNB to Collect and Remit Transient Occupancy Tax <br />(TOT) (304) <br />Recommendation: <br />Authorize the City Manager to sign the attached Voluntary Collection <br />Agreement with Airbnb, which requires Airbnb, Inc. to collect and remit TOT <br />to the City of Redwood City MINUTE ORDER 18-091 <br />C. Award of Contract - 2017-2018 Sanitary Sewer Replacement Project <br />(304) <br />Recommendation: <br />By motion, approve and authorize the City Manager to execute the contract <br />documents and award the standard form construction contract 00520 for the <br />2017-2018 Sanitary Sewer Replacement Project to the lowest responsible <br />bidder, Casey Construction Inc. of Emerald Hills, California, and waive any <br />irregularities, for their low bid of $4,488,680; and, authorize the City Manager <br />to increase the contract amount, if necessary, up to 10% of the original <br />contract amount, not to exceed $4,937,548; and confirm determination that <br />the project is exempt and meets California Environmental Quality Act <br />(CEQA) exemption criteria as set forth in Section 15302 (Replacement or <br />Reconstruction) of the CEQA Regulations MINUTE ORDER 18-092 <br />D.
